    Hello Friend,
    IRS is simply known as Indian Revenue Service.IRS officer is the 4th most respected officer of civil service after the IAS,IPS,IFS's.
    Eligibility Required:
    1.Any degree from a recognized University is the minimum qualification required to appear the exam.
    2.The minimum age to appear the IRS exam would be 21 year to 30 year of age on 1st August of the year of examination.Upper age limit is relaxed for certain reserved categories.
    3.candidate who are applying for the exam should have Indian citizenship.

    Exam Procedure:
    The IRS exam conducted by UPSC (Union Public Service Commission).The aspirant has to procure the application form from any of the post office /head post office spread all over the country.In month of May/June the aspirant have to take the preliminary exam consist of 2 papers.this exam is just a qualifying exam.After that the final exam is held in normally month of October. Those candidate who qualified in the preliminary exam are supposed to take the final exam.Once you are qualified the test the final stage is interview to test their personality & mental ability.
    To become an IRS officer one can qualifying the entrance exam with a good rank.

    IRS stands for Indian Revenue Service.

    UPSC conducts the recruitment for the post of IRS through Civil Service exam.

    This exam is conducted once in a year at national level.

    Graduated candidates can apply for the Civil Service exam.

    You can also apply in final year of graduation.

    Your age should be 21 to 30 years.

    5 years of age relaxation for SC/ST and 3 years of age relaxation for OBC

    You should be Indian.
